jbripley Posted February 19, 2019 Share #188 Posted February 19, 2019 (edited) 8 minutes ago, NERICSSON said: would ISO be adjustable via the wheel? /Niklas On the CL, the righthand wheel supports the same kind of set up that the FN button has since FW 3.0 for the Q. You can turn on/off a choice of settings and assign one of them to be activated when the inner button is pushed. I would imagine EV would be the default assigned setting, which you then could change to be ISO instead.
